abstract | - It is recommended to spend the exp from the lamp on expensive or slow skills, such as Prayer, Construction or Herblore. Spending the lamp on these skills can potentially save you millions of coins, as Prayer and Herblore can cost up to millions of coins and hours of training. Some examples: 1.
* If a player uses the lamp on prayer at level 75, it will save them roughly coins, assuming the player buys 73 dragon bones for coins and use them in the Ectofuntus. 2.
* If the player had 81 Herblore, the lamp would save coins assuming the player was making 147 Saradomin brews and losing coins per potion by buying toadflax potions (unf) and crushed nests. 3.
* If the player had 90 Construction, the lamp would save coins assuming the player used only 258 mahogany planks bought for the GE price of each. The dragonkin lamp can be used to gain experience in any skill. The amount of experience gained depends on the player's level in that skill (see calculator and chart below). After using a Dragonkin Lamp the player receives the message: "As you focus on your chosen memories, you feel a burning malevolence in the back of your mind. You have gained new insight into [skill]... but at what cost?". The significance of this message is unknown and could hint at a sinister aspect of the lamp's powers. Note: Should you die with a Dragonkin lamp in your inventory, it WILL appear at your gravestone. An approximate for the experience gained is calculated by taking the level cubed and dividing that by 20.2 (Level^3/20.2).
